    How to Choose the Right Loan for Your Child’s Education

    As a parent, you want to give your child the greatest education possible. However, the expense of education can be overwhelming, and many families struggle to afford it.

    This is where education loans come in. Education loans are intended to assist families in paying for their children’s education by providing them with the finances they need.

    However, with so many different types of education loans available, it can be challenging to choose the right one.

    Here are some important considerations to consider while choosing the right loan for your child’s education.

    Loan amount: The first step in selecting a loan is determining how much money you will require. Tuition, books, and other educational-related expenditures are included. It is important to be realistic about how much money you will need and to avoid borrowing more than you can afford to repay.

    Interest rates: An education loan’s interest rate determines the overall cost of the loan over time. To obtain the best price, compare interest rates from different lenders. Some lenders may offer lower interest rates for specific sorts of loans, so do your research.

    Repayment terms: The repayment terms of an education loan can also have a substantial impact on the loan’s cost. Some loans require you to begin repaying the loan as soon as you receive it, while others may enable you to defer repayment until your child has completed their education. Make sure you understand the loan’s repayment terms and that you are okay with the terms.

    Eligibility requirements: Because different school loans have varying eligibility requirements, it is critical to understand what you must do to qualify for the loan. Some loans may require a co-signer or evidence of income, but others may be available to anyone regardless of financial circumstances.

    Loan flexibility: Consider the flexibility of the loan in terms of repayment terms and interest rates. Some loans may have adjustable payback terms, allowing you to tailor the loan to your changing financial circumstances. Others may allow you to switch from a fixed to a variable interest rate.

    Loan security: Some education loans may be secured by collateral, such as a home or car, whereas others may be unsecured. Secured loans normally feature lower interest rates, but if you are unable to make the payments, you may lose the collateral. It is always good to consider unsecured loans like Ecobank’s Edusave Loan.

    Loan fees: It’s important to consider any fees associated with the loan, such as application fees, origination fees, and prepayment penalties. It’s essential to understand what costs you will be accountable for and to consider them when making your decision because they can significantly increase the cost of the loan. You can also look at options where there are discounts on loan fees such as the Edusave Loan’s 50% discount on arrangement fees.

    In conclusion, selecting the best education loan for your child’s education is a big decision. When making your decision, take into account the loan amount, interest rates, payback terms, eligibility conditions, loan flexibility, loan security, and loan costs. You can help ensure that your child receives the education they deserve by taking the time to explore your options and selecting the best loan for your requirements.
